How is Tempered Glass Actually Made?

The process for making tempered glass is pretty intense. It starts with standard glass, which is heated to over 1,000°F and then rapidly cooled with high-pressure air jets. This quick-cooling process, called quenching, makes the outer surfaces of the glass cool and contract faster than the center. As the center cools, it pulls on the outer surfaces, creating a state of constant tension in the middle and compression on the outside. This internal stress is what gives tempered glass its signature strength—about four times stronger than regular glass—and causes it to break in a unique way.

How Their Materials and Manufacturing Differ

The manufacturing process is what gives each material its unique properties. Tempered glass is made by heating standard glass and then cooling its outer surfaces rapidly. This process creates tension, making it about four times stronger than regular glass. When it breaks, it shatters into small, pebble-like pieces instead of sharp shards. On the other hand, ceramic glass is a completely different material. Brands like Pyroceram® and NeoCeram® are created through a process that gives them an extremely low coefficient of thermal expansion. This means the material barely expands or contracts when heated or cooled, allowing it to endure intense, direct heat without cracking. Why Glass Thickness Matters (3mm Minimum)

Thickness is another key piece of the safety puzzle. For wood stove applications, the industry standard is a thickness of 3 millimeters (about 1/8 inch). This specific thickness provides the right balance of strength and heat transfer. It’s robust enough to resist impacts and the pressure changes inside the firebox without being so thick that it retains too much heat, which could cause it to fail. When you're shopping for a replacement, always confirm that the glass you’re considering meets this minimum 3mm requirement. Anything less is a compromise on safety and durability.

Mica Glass for Antique Stoves

If you own an antique wood stove, you might have encountered a different type of material in the door: mica. Mica is a naturally occurring mineral that can be split into thin, transparent sheets. For many older stoves, these thin, clear panels were the original "glass." While it served its purpose in vintage designs, mica is not the same as modern ceramic glass and isn't suitable for today's high-efficiency stoves. It's more fragile and can't withstand the same intense, direct heat. If you're restoring an antique, finding authentic mica sheets might be part of the project, but for any modern stove, you need the superior safety and durability of a true glass-ceramic panel.

What About Pyrex?

It’s a common question: "Can I use Pyrex in my wood stove?" Since it’s used for baking, it seems like a logical, heat-safe option. However, the answer is a firm no. Pyrex is a type of borosilicate or tempered glass designed for the even, controlled heat of an oven, which rarely exceeds 500°F. It is absolutely not built to handle the intense, direct flames of a wood stove, where temperatures can soar past 1,000°F. Just like standard tempered glass, Pyrex will shatter violently when exposed to the thermal shock and extreme heat inside a firebox. Using it would create an incredibly dangerous situation, so stick with materials made for the job.

The Critical 1/8" Expansion Gap

This might sound counterintuitive, but when you're ordering a custom-cut piece, you need to make it slightly smaller than the opening. Specifically, you should subtract 1/8 of an inch from both the height and width of your measurement. This creates a small but essential expansion gap. While ceramic glass is engineered to have a very low thermal expansion rate, it still expands a tiny bit when exposed to the intense heat of a fire. Without this gap, the glass would press directly against the rigid metal frame of your stove door as it heats up. That pressure has to go somewhere, and it often results in the glass cracking or even shattering—not because the material was wrong, but because the fit was too tight. Following this simple rule is the key to a safe, long-lasting installation.

Always Install a New Gasket

When you replace your stove glass, you should always replace the gasket, too. This flat, tape-like seal is what cushions the glass against the metal door and creates that all-important airtight seal. Your old gasket has been compressed by heat and pressure, and it won't provide the same protection for your new glass. Reusing it can create an uneven seal, which can lead to air leaks or create pressure points that cause the new glass to crack. A fresh, high-temperature gasket is an inexpensive but essential part of the job, ensuring your stove is both safe and efficient.

Avoid Over-tightening Retainer Clips

It might be tempting to tighten the screws on the retainer clips as much as possible, but this is one of the most common mistakes people make. Your new ceramic glass needs a little bit of room to expand slightly when it heats up. If the clips are too tight, they'll put pressure on the glass as it expands, which can easily cause it to crack. The hardware should be just snug enough to hold the glass securely in place without any rattling. Think "finger-tight" plus a small turn with a screwdriver—not cranked down with all your strength.

How to Safely Clean Your Stove Glass

To keep a clear view of your fire, you’ll want to clean the glass periodically. First, always make sure the stove is completely cool before you start. You can use a standard glass cleaner or a specialized wood stove glass cleaner with a soft cloth or paper towel. Avoid using anything abrasive, like scouring pads or harsh chemical cleaners, as they can scratch or damage the glass surface. A popular and effective DIY trick is to dip a damp paper towel in cool wood ash from your firebox—the fine ash acts as a gentle abrasive to scrub away soot without scratching the glass.

Troubleshooting: What Dirty Glass Can Tell You

If you find your glass is constantly covered in black soot, it might be a sign of an underlying issue. Persistent, heavy soot buildup often means your fire isn't burning hot enough, which can be caused by burning unseasoned, wet wood. It could also indicate that your stove's air vents aren't open enough to allow for complete combustion. A properly burning fire is more efficient and produces less creosote. If your stove has one, a failing catalytic combustor can also contribute to dirty glass. Paying attention to the glass can help you troubleshoot your stove's performance and burn more efficiently.
